当前位置:首页 > 科技 > 正文

空间填充与功率平衡:构建高效系统的双面镜

  • 科技
  • 2025-04-23 18:55:24
  • 6835
摘要: 在当代信息技术领域,空间填充和功率平衡作为两大关键技术,在大数据处理、云计算等众多应用场景中发挥着至关重要的作用。本文将通过问答的形式深入探讨这两个关键词的含义、原理及应用,旨在为读者提供全面而精准的知识介绍。# 一、什么是空间填充?问:空间填充具体是指什...

在当代信息技术领域,空间填充和功率平衡作为两大关键技术,在大数据处理、云计算等众多应用场景中发挥着至关重要的作用。本文将通过问答的形式深入探讨这两个关键词的含义、原理及应用,旨在为读者提供全面而精准的知识介绍。

# 一、什么是空间填充?

问:空间填充具体是指什么?

答:空间填充(Space Filling)是一种用于优化数据存储和检索的技术,主要应用于多维索引结构中。其目标是通过合理的布局方式,在有限的空间内达到最佳的查询性能与存储效率。

在大数据处理领域,尤其是涉及高维数据集时,传统的一维排序算法可能难以满足需求。空间填充曲线(如曼德勃罗螺旋线)能够将多维空间中的点映射到一维上,从而保留了相邻点之间的相对距离关系。这种方法不仅有助于提高查询速度,还能降低内存消耗,使得大规模数据分析变得更加高效。

问:空间填充有哪些主要应用场景?

答:空间填充技术广泛应用于各种场景中,其中最典型的应用包括:

1. 地理信息系统(GIS):在GIS中,空间填充可用于优化存储和检索位置信息,从而提高地图操作的效率。

2. 数据库管理:特别是在处理高维数据集时,空间填充能够显著提升查询性能,降低存储成本。

3. 图像与视频压缩:通过将二维或三维像素映射到一维索引结构中,可以实现更高效的编码和解码过程。

空间填充与功率平衡:构建高效系统的双面镜

# 二、功率平衡:优化资源分配的核心策略

问:什么是功率平衡?

答:功率平衡(Power Balancing)是一种动态调整系统内各组件之间能量分配的技术。其主要目的在于确保在不同负载条件下,各部分都能够获得适当的资源支持,从而实现系统的稳定运行。

该技术常用于云计算环境中,通过智能地调节虚拟机、容器等实例的CPU和内存使用量来平衡整体计算资源。此外,在边缘计算场景下,功率平衡也被用来优化无线网络中的能量消耗模式,使得设备能够在满足业务需求的同时减少能耗。

空间填充与功率平衡:构建高效系统的双面镜

问:如何实现功率平衡?

答:实现功率平衡主要依靠以下几种策略:

1. 自适应调度算法:根据实时负载情况动态调整任务分配,确保每个节点都在其最佳状态下运行。

2. 资源预留机制:预先为关键服务保留一定比例的计算能力,以应对突发需求。

空间填充与功率平衡:构建高效系统的双面镜

3. 能耗管理技术:通过智能硬件和软件相结合的方法,优化功耗控制策略。

# 三、空间填充与功率平衡之间的联系

尽管空间填充侧重于数据结构设计层面的问题,而功率平衡则更多关注系统运行时的状态调整,但两者之间存在着密切的内在联系。具体表现为:

1. 共同目标:二者都致力于提高系统的整体性能和效率。

空间填充与功率平衡:构建高效系统的双面镜

2. 互补作用:在构建复杂信息系统的过程中,合理运用空间填充技术可以为功率平衡提供更佳的基础架构支持;反之,优化后的资源配置也能进一步提升数据处理速度。

# 四、实际案例分析

让我们以一个具体应用场景为例来说明这两项技术的实际效果:

假设某企业需要建立一套能够支持大规模数据分析的基础设施。该系统不仅需要高效地存储和检索海量非结构化数据(如日志文件),还需要能够在不同时间尺度下灵活扩展计算资源。

空间填充与功率平衡:构建高效系统的双面镜

在这种情况下,工程师可以采用LZ曲线进行空间填充操作,将二维坐标转换成一维索引形式,从而简化复杂的数据结构;同时,在实际运行阶段利用基于机器学习的自适应调度算法实现动态功率平衡。这样一来,系统不仅能够以较低的成本完成任务执行,还能在遇到突发事件时快速作出响应。

# 五、未来展望

随着5G、物联网等新兴技术的发展,对于高性能且低功耗的数据处理平台需求日益增加。可以预见的是,空间填充与功率平衡将更加紧密地结合起来,并探索更多创新性的解决方案以应对未来的挑战。

总结而言,空间填充和功率平衡是构建现代化信息技术体系不可或缺的两个核心概念。通过不断深入研究并将其应用于实际项目中,我们有望进一步推动整个行业向前迈进一大步。

空间填充与功率平衡:构建高效系统的双面镜